Fabrikoid is the test-data factory library used by every service in the Larkspur platform. If fixtures fail to build during an incident, check the schema snapshots under `fabrikoid/schemas` first — stale snapshots cause roughly ninety percent of pages. Do not regenerate snapshots on a release branch without approval, as downstream teams pin exact fixture hashes. Escalations outside business hours should go through the Larkspur on-call rotation. The engineer ultimately accountable for Fabrikoid's correctness and releases is named below.

named custodian: Oliath Ralax

## Formula sandbox tuning

User-supplied formulas in Gridmoor execute inside a restricted interpreter with hard ceilings on time, memory, and call depth. Reviewers should confirm any change to these ceilings is justified in the PR description, since raising them widens the abuse surface. Defaults were chosen from production traces. The current limits are as follows.

limits module of tafog-fawip:
WEIGHTS = {
    "julix": 57,
    "lamys": 992,
    "kasvan": 209,
    "quenok": 750,
    "alddor": 259,
    "oliath": 1009,
    "wenix": 815,
}

Audit item 14: SQL lint rules. Verify all files in the Quarrystone repo pass the lint suite — no SELECT *, required schema prefixes, lowercase keywords banned in migrations. Support team: lint failures block merges automatically; do not grant overrides. Exceptions need a documented waiver. Waivers are issued only by the rule owner named below.

named custodian: Brivan Eliath Quenox Frador

The Quiet Room sits on the top floor of Wrenfield House, past the lift lobby. New starters can use it anytime for focused work — no bookings, no talking, phones on silent. Your badge opens the stairwell, but the room itself has a keypad. Enter using the current code below.

turnstile pass: bdg-MWRUHE-76377440